Output 22c07937c24607be88ac3ef1c944241feac27987042b1e45fe5e94de1d985307:0

value
2621610
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64ec2890aebeb7adcce249e3b6a48eb5f4ea4a7f OP_EQUAL
address
3AteQJbEfG9vvPAd8ZY4m4VkpojTWfta2q
transaction
22c07937c24607be88ac3ef1c944241feac27987042b1e45fe5e94de1d985307
confirmations
177871
spent
true